Miami Crime Scores by Zip Code API

The Miami Crime Scores by Zip Code API offers real-time crime risk data for each zip code in Miami. Access detailed crime categories and historical trends for informed decision-making in safety-focused applications. Ideal for developers seeking precise, location-specific crime insights in the Miami area.

About the API:  

The Miami Crime Scores by Zip Code API is an invaluable tool for accessing comprehensive crime data tailored to specific zip codes within Miami. This API provides users with real-time crime risk assessments, allowing them to gauge the safety levels of different areas in the city accurately. By inputting a zip code, users can access detailed crime categories and historical trends, empowering them to make informed decisions regarding safety considerations.

In addition to offering real-time crime scores, the API categorizes crimes into various types such as theft, assault, burglary, vandalism, and more. This granular level of detail enables users to gain insights into the specific nature and frequency of crimes occurring within each zip code.

Moreover, the API includes historical crime data, allowing users to analyze crime trends over time and identify patterns or fluctuations in crime rates within specific areas. This feature is particularly beneficial for urban planners, law enforcement agencies, and community organizations involved in crime prevention and safety initiatives.

With seamless integration capabilities, developers can incorporate this API into their applications to provide users with accurate and up-to-date crime information for Miami zip codes. Whether developing mobile apps, real estate platforms, or community safety tools, the Miami Crime Scores by Zip Code API equips developers with essential data for enhancing safety-conscious applications and services.

API Documentation

Endpoints


Just with the ZIP code to analyze, you will be receiving a JSON object with an Overall Crime Scoring, and also a breakdown of different crimes that are assessed on the zone. 

Get information like:

  • "Overall Crime Grade".
  • "Violent Crime Grade".
  • "Property Crime Grade".
  • "Other Crime Grade".
  • "Violent Crime Rates".
  • "Property Crime Rates".
  • "Other Crime Rates".
  • "Crime Rates Nearby".
  • "Similar Population Crime Rates".


                                                                            
GET https://zylalabs.com/api/4193/miami++crime+scores+by+zip+code+api/5077/get+data+by+zip
                                                                            
                                                                        

Get Data by Zip - Endpoint Features

Object Description
zip [Required] ZIP Code to retrieve crime data from.

Miami Crime Scores by Zip Code API FAQs

he API includes a comprehensive dataset covering various types of crimes, such as property crimes (e.g., theft, burglary), violent crimes (e.g., assault, robbery), vandalism, and other criminal activities reported within Miami zip codes. Each crime type is categorized and analyzed separately for detailed insights.

The crime scores are derived from a combination of local law enforcement agencies, FBI reports, and other reliable crime data sources. The data is aggregated and normalized to provide consistent and comprehensive scores.

Crime scores are calculated using a proprietary algorithm that considers various factors such as the number and severity of reported crimes, population density, and historical crime trends. The algorithm normalizes data to account for discrepancies between different reporting agencie

The API returns data in JSON format, which is widely supported and easily integrated into various applications and systems. The JSON format provides a structured and readable way to access the crime scores and related information.

Yes, the API has usage limits to ensure fair access and performance stability. The limits depend on your subscription plan, with higher-tier plans offering more API calls per month. Rate limiting mechanisms are in place to prevent abuse.

The "Get Data by Zip" endpoint returns a JSON object containing an overall crime score, detailed crime grades (violent, property, and other), crime rates, and a breakdown of specific crime types for the requested zip code.

Key fields in the response include "Overall Crime Grade," "Violent Crime Grade," "Property Crime Grade," "Crime Rates Nearby," and detailed breakdowns for specific crimes like assault, robbery, and theft.

The response data is structured in two main sections: "Overall," which summarizes the crime scores, and "Crime BreakDown," which provides detailed statistics for violent and property crimes, including rates for specific offenses.

The endpoint provides information on overall crime scores, grades for violent and property crimes, specific crime rates, and comparisons to nearby areas and similar populations, enabling comprehensive safety assessments.

Users can customize their requests by specifying the zip code they wish to analyze. The API is designed to return tailored crime data based on the provided zip code input.

"Overall Crime Grade" indicates the general safety level of the area, while "Violent Crime Grade" and "Property Crime Grade" assess specific crime categories. "Risk" quantifies the likelihood of crime occurrence relative to a baseline.

Data accuracy is maintained through aggregation from multiple reliable sources, including local law enforcement and FBI reports. Regular updates and normalization processes ensure consistency and reliability in the crime scores.

To check how many API calls you have left for the current month, refer to the β€˜X-Zyla-API-Calls-Monthly-Remaining’ field in the response header. For example, if your plan allows 1,000 requests per month and you've used 100, this field in the response header will indicate 900 remaining calls.

To see the maximum number of API requests your plan allows, check the β€˜X-Zyla-RateLimit-Limit’ response header. For instance, if your plan includes 1,000 requests per month, this header will display 1,000.

The β€˜X-Zyla-RateLimit-Reset’ header shows the number of seconds until your rate limit resets. This tells you when your request count will start fresh. For example, if it displays 3,600, it means 3,600 seconds are left until the limit resets.
